When life forces you to slow down, sometimes that’s exactly what your family needs. In this raw, real “I’ll Do Better Tomorrow,” Justin and Kylie share how a tough week - complete with surgery, surf trips, and kids cooking dinner - led to surprising moments of growth and gratitude. It’s a gentle reminder that slowing down doesn’t mean falling behind.

ACTION STEPS FOR PARENTS

  1. Let someone else lead for a day.
  2. Involve kids in cooking or chores—real, meaningful help.
  3. Reflect: where can you slow down before the season speeds up?
